Cebuano

[edit]

Etymology

[edit]

Inherited from Proto-Philippine *baqug (spoiled; sterile).

Pronunciation 1

[edit]
  • Hyphenation: ba‧og
  • IPA(key): /baˈʔoɡ/, [bɐˈʔoɡ]

Adjective

[edit]

baóg

  1. rotten
  2. addled
    Synonym: bugok

Verb

[edit]

baóg

  1. to cause for eggs to be rotten or addled

Pronunciation 2

[edit]
  • Hyphenation: ba‧og
  • IPA(key): /ˈbaʔoɡ/, [ˈba.ʔoɡ]

Adjective

[edit]

báog

  1. constipated
    Synonym: tubol
